What affects the price

Roof repair costs depend on a few key factors. First, the size of the damaged area matters, as does the specific type of roofing material you have, like shingles, tile, or metal. If there is underlying structural rot or water damage to the wood decking, that adds to the scope of work. Accessibility also plays a role—steep roofs or those requiring specialized equipment to reach safely can increase labor time. We also consider the complexity of the vents, chimneys, or skylights involved in the repair.

What are single-ply roofing membranes used for?

Single-ply roofing membranes are often used for flat or low-slope roofs, which are common on commercial buildings but can also be found on some homes in Los Angeles. These durable, waterproof sheets provide excellent protection against the elements. They're known for their longevity and resistance to UV rays and extreme temperatures. Proper installation is crucial for their performance.

When is roofing tar typically used?

Roofing tar, or asphalt-based sealant, is generally used for minor repairs or sealing small gaps and seams on certain types of roofs. It can help prevent water intrusion in specific areas. However, it's not usually the primary solution for major leaks or widespread damage. For more significant issues, professionals will opt for more robust materials and repair methods to ensure long-term protection.

What are the advantages of a steel roof?

A steel roof offers significant advantages, especially in a climate like Los Angeles. They are incredibly durable, can withstand high winds, and often have a longer lifespan than traditional shingles. Steel roofs are also fire-resistant and can be energy-efficient, reflecting solar heat. While the initial investment might be higher, the long-term benefits often make it a worthwhile choice for homeowners.
